Analysis

The most recent figure for households and npishs final consumption expenditure (constant 2015) in Nicaragua is 1,878 constant 2015 US$ per person, measured in 2025.

The figure is up 4.4% on the previous year and up 28.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, households and npishs final consumption expenditure (constant 2015) in Nicaragua peaked at 1,887 constant 2015 US$ per person in 1977 and was at its lowest, 645.34 constant 2015 US$ per person, in 1987.

That places Nicaragua 127th out of 172 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

How this figure is calculated

Households and NPISHs Final consumption expenditure (constant 2015 US$)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Households and NPISHs Final consumption expenditure (constant 2015 US$) ÷ Population, total
